It’s seafood and it’s dinner… fish, shrimp, and scallops simmered in broth that is very tasty!
Preparation time
- Prep Time 15 mins
- Total Time 35 mins
- Servings 4-6
Ingredients
- 1 lb scallops ( I prefer the small ones)
- 1 lb shrimp, peeled and deveined
- 1 1/2 lbs cod ( or other mild white fish)
- 1 (16 ounce) jars salsa ( mild or hot, your choice)
- 1 cup dry white wine
- 1 cup chicken broth
- 1 lemon
- 2 tablespoons butter ( not margarine)
- 1 -2 tablespoon olive oil
- kosher salt
- ground black pepper
Directions
- Heat olive oil and butter over medium heat.
- Cut fish into large chunks and sprinkle with salt and pepper, to taste and brown lightly in oil and butter (about 1 minute per side).
- Remove fish from pan and set aside.
- Add wine (careful to keep wine from direct heat while pouring into pan) and deglaze pan.
- Stir in jar of salsa and chicken broth. Let broth simmer over medium heat until liquid begins to bubble.
- Add scallops and shrimp to broth, stir gently, cover, and let simmer for 10 minutes.
- Cut lemon in half, squeeze juice into pan.
- Add fish back to pan and gently stir.
- Replace cover and simmer another 6-7 minutes.
- Serve in large bowls with crunchy bread and enjoy!
